I posted a few weeks back about the immature, disrespectful behavior of Republican Rep. Fillmore in the wee hours of the morning during budget talks. He claimed to support a Democratic amendment, then praised Dems for their public service. After a minute of seeming sincerity, he shouted, "April Fools," and trashed the Democrats. Here is Steve Farley's description of the incident:

We felt a small bit of hope at one point when Rep. John Fillmore (R-Apache Junction) rose to say that he actually supported an amendment by Anna Tovar (D-Tolleson) to restore transplant funding and pay for it entirely in private funds. He praised our arguments from the entire evening and our public service, and the articulate way in which we stood up for Arizonans. Our tired spirits as Democrats were lifted by the vision of a Republican actually saying nice things about us and acknowledging our hard work in opposition.

Then he yelled out "April Fools!" and went on to trash everything we stood for. The harshly partisan and mean-spirited nature of the process and majority rhetoric on the floor was revealed once again in a particularly nasty way. Needless to say, not many of us Democrats were laughing.

The AZ Dems have posted a two minute video of the incident, a damning indictment of the petty, mean spirited attitude the Republicans have adopted as their governing style.
